Warranty conditions
FSN+ respects the manufacturer's warranty conditions and follows them in its procedures. Before making a warranty claim, it is important that you read the warranty conditions carefully. Claims under these warranty conditions must always be submitted via the FSNplus website. FSN+ determines, in consultation with the manufacturer, whether or not you are eligible for warranty coverage. To avoid excessive searching through the warranty conditions, the reasons for the warranty becoming void and the liability that is excluded from warranty coverage are briefly listed below:
The warranty expires:
In case of incorrect and/or careless use of the bicycle and use that is not in accordance with the intended purpose;
If the bicycle has not been maintained in accordance with the service guidelines;
If technical repairs have not been carried out professionally;
If subsequently fitted parts do not correspond to the technical specification of the bicycle in question or are incorrectly fitted;
If the bicycle has changed ownership.
No warranty is given on rotating and wear-prone parts!
We strongly advise you to have a maintenance service performed after 3 months, and to repeat this every year.
Furthermore, liability for damage to (parts of) the bicycle as a result of: is expressly excluded.
Failure to replace parts such as brake/derailleur cables, brake pads, tires, chain, and sprockets in a timely manner;
Incorrect adjustment/tension of handlebars, stem, saddle, seat post, derailleur set, brakes, quick releases;
Climatic influences such as normal weathering of paint or chrome rust.
As a valued customer of Alete bikes (Denver, Villettte, Urban Move, Llobe, Carratt, Nassau) , you benefit from a warranty that protects your bike against
manufacturing defects, according to the conditions described below. In accordance with Directive 2019/771/EU, we are committed to providing high-quality products and reliable service.
We would also like to inform you that we have classified each bicycle into a category based on the intended use of the model.
CATEGORY 1 – ROAD BIKES, RECREATIONAL BIKES AND CITY BIKES
Suitable for use exclusively on paved roads and cycle paths. Wheels remain in continuous contact with the ground (no jumping, no riding on one wheel).
CATEGORY 2 – CROSS, TREKKING, CYCLOCROSS AND GRAVEL BIKES
Suitable for paved roads and bike paths and compact terrain (gravel, sand, unpaved).
Obstacles up to 15 cm are allowed without jumping or riding on one wheel.
CATEGORY 3 – MTB HARDTAIL / FULL (MAX. 130 mm SUSPENSION TRAVEL)
Suitable for forest roads and technical trails with obstacles such as roots, stones, and steps up to 0.6 m.
CATEGORY 4 – MTB MAX. 160 mm SUSPENSION TRAVEL
Suitable for tough technical trails and bike parks with obstacles up to 1 m.
CATEGORY 5 – CARGO BIKES (UP TO 180 kg)
Suitable for paved roads and cycle paths.
Procedure for warranty claims:
The application must be submitted via the point of sale and must contain:
– Batch number (on frame or manual)
– Photo of the bicycle (side view)
– Proof of purchase
– Photo/video of the defect
Warranty exclusions:
– Incorrect use or maintenance
– Unauthorized changes
– Normal wear and tear
– Professional or rental use
– Overloading or match use
Battery guidelines:
– Do not cause a short circuit
– Do not expose to heat or moisture
– Recharge monthly
– Use only the original charger
